Relative Search:
Baidu Google
Edit this listing

Touch Star Communications

5910 Princess Garden Pkwy
Lanham , MD 20706
301-577-9180
Category

Driving Directions

From:
To: 5910 Princess Garden Pkwy ,Lanham , MD 20706